What happened after Dan found out Dani went into labour?

Reflecting on the day months later, Dan told WHO that the moment he received that call and had to wrap up his time on The Block was quite the “head spin”.

“It was a Thursday on site [when Dani rang],” he said. “And she goes, ‘We are having the baby tomorrow’.

“And you’re thinking to yourself, s–t. It was a bit of a head spin.”

Before leaving, Dan had to speed through a series of tasks for the show.

“We had to get some promo, had to do some McCafe stuff, had to do some budgeting stuff that day, and then had to run around site, try and tell everyone what I’ve been checking in on,” he explained. “I still had to get signed off for the contestants with fireplaces and barbecues.

“I had to do a big handover in not a lot of time, and it was pretty funny watching it back and going back to that moment.”

Advertisement

Dan recalled that he and Dani drove to Melbourne at around two o’clock in the afternoon, stayed the night in Melbourne, and then Fletcher, their baby boy, was born around two-to-three o’clock the next afternoon on April 10.

How long will Foreman Dan be away from The Block?

Before the show even started filming, Dan and production knew that the baby would be coming sometime throughout the show.

Advertisement

“So I asked if I could have the two weeks off when the baby came,” he said, which production, of course, granted. “It was really nice to be at home with Dani at that time for two weeks.

“I do pop in once in the middle of that to say hello, but yeah, it was a nice little holiday away from The Block for two weeks.”
